HDK
|
This is the complete list of members for TypeSyntax, including all inherited members.
_defaultValue | TypeSyntax | protected |
_members | TypeSyntax | protected |
_name | TypeSyntax | protected |
_typeAlias | TypeSyntax | protected |
_typeDefinition | TypeSyntax | protected |
_uniformDefaultValue | TypeSyntax | protected |
EMPTY_MEMBERS | TypeSyntax | protectedstatic |
getDefaultValue(bool uniform) const | TypeSyntax | inline |
getMembers() const | TypeSyntax | inline |
getName() const | TypeSyntax | inline |
getTypeAlias() const | TypeSyntax | inline |
getTypeDefinition() const | TypeSyntax | inline |
getValue(const ShaderPort *port, bool uniform) const | TypeSyntax | virtual |
getValue(const Value &value, bool uniform) const =0 | TypeSyntax | pure virtual |
getValue(const StringVec &values, bool uniform) const =0 | TypeSyntax | pure virtual |
TypeSyntax(const string &name, const string &defaultValue, const string &uniformDefaultValue, const string &typeAlias, const string &typeDefinition, const StringVec &members) | TypeSyntax | protected |
~TypeSyntax() | TypeSyntax | inlinevirtual |